115 years ago today - Oct 24, 1901

[J. Golden Kimball]
Attended the regular meeting of the Pres[iden]tcy, and Apostles in the Temple at 10.30 a.m. ... Pres[iden]t. Jos[eph]. F. Smith mentioned the name of his oldest son Hyrum M. Smith to fill the vacancy in the Quo[rum]. of Twelve. His recommendation was unanimously sustained, though the wisdom of this action at this time was questioned by some of the brethren. I also stated that Jos[eph]. F[ielding]. [Smith] Jr. was my favorite among Pres[iden]t. Smith's sons.

[Source: J. Golden Kimball, Diary, as quoted in Minutes of the Apostles of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, 1835-1951, Electronic Edition, 2015]
